From 77963078a27fb82ec2b81675384ed7a4b6580fec Mon Sep 17 00:00:00 2001 From: Harshavardhana Date: Wed, 11 Sep 2019 16:27:11 -0700 Subject: [PATCH] Remove maintainers.md use only contributing.md (#8215) --- MAINTAINERS.md | 37 ------------------------------------- 1 file changed, 37 deletions(-) delete mode 100644 MAINTAINERS.md diff --git a/MAINTAINERS.md b/MAINTAINERS.md deleted file mode 100644 index a36e221d1..000000000 --- a/MAINTAINERS.md +++ /dev/null @@ -1,37 +0,0 @@ -# For maintainers only - -### Setup your minio GitHub Repository - -Fork [minio upstream](https://github.com/minio/minio/fork) source repository to your own personal repository. -```bash -$ mkdir -p $GOPATH/src/github.com/minio -$ cd $GOPATH/src/github.com/minio -$ git clone https://github.com/$USER_ID/minio -$ -``` - -``minio`` uses [govendor](https://github.com/kardianos/govendor) for its dependency management. - -### To manage dependencies - -#### Add new dependencies - - - Run `go get foo/bar` - - Edit your code to import foo/bar - - Run `govendor add foo/bar` from top-level directory - -#### Remove dependencies - - - Run `govendor remove foo/bar` - -#### Update dependencies - - - Run `govendor remove +vendor` - - Run to update the dependent package `go get -u foo/bar` - - Run `govendor add +external` - -### Making new releases - -`minio` doesn't follow semantic versioning style, `minio` instead uses the release date and time as the release versions. - -`make release` will generate new binary into `release` directory.